1 Intel(R) Minnowboard Max {#minnowmax}
2 ========================
3 MinnowBoard MAX is an open hardware embedded board designed with the Intel(R)
4 Atom(TM) E38xx series SOC (Fromerly Bay Trail).

23 The low speed I/O connector supported as per table below. This assumes default
24 BIOS settings, as they are not dynamcially detected If any changes are mode
25 (Device Manager -> System Setup -> South Cluster -> LPSS & CSS) them mraa calls
26 will not behave as expected.
